How much does it cost to rent a home in Six Points?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Six Points 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,063 | $1,650 | $2,765 |
| Six Points 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,449 | $2,115 | $2,900 |
| Six Points 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,650 | $2,650 | $2,650 |

Cheapest Available Six Points Apartments for Rent
 The cheapest available apartment rental in the Six Points area of Plainfield, IN is a 2 Beds unit found at Harpers Crossing priced from $1,012. Crown Plaza has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$1,195. Here are the most affordable Six Points apartments for rent in Plainfield, IN: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Bed/Bath |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Harpers Crossing | 2 Bedroom | 2BR,1BA | $1,012 |
| Crown Plaza | Dover | 1BR,1BA | $1,195 |
| Canyon Club at Perry Crossing | Gem (A) | 1BR,1BA | $1,273 |
| Lakeside at Walnut Hills | 2 Bed 1 Bath | 2BR,1BA | $1,295 |
| Central Park Apartments | Park Avenue | 1 Bedroom 1 Bathroom and 763 Squa... | 1BR,1BA | $1,319 |
